L'explorateur Ben Saunders raconte son extraordinaire périple au Pôle Nord, enrichi par des anecdotes prenantes, des photographies magnifiques et des vidéos jamais diffusées.

In 2004, Ben Saunders became the youngest person ever to ski solo to the North Pole. In 2011, he’ll set out on another record-breaking expedition, this time to be the fastest person to walk solo to the North Pole. Full bio »
